List of drug hits increasing yeast extract productivity.

Drug Mode of action Targets
Bosutinib ATP-competitive tyrosine kinase inhibitor (BCR-ABL/SRC) Tyrosine kinases BCR, ABL1, LYN, HCK, SRC
Serine/threonine kinases CDK2, MAP2K1, MAP2K2, MAP3K2, CAMK2G
ATP-dependent efflux pump ABCB1
Cerdulatinib ATP-competitive tyrosine kinase inhibitor (SYK/JAK) Tyrosine kinases SYK, JAK1/2/3, TYK2
Dasatinib monohydrate ATP-competitive tyrosine kinase inhibitor (SRC family) Tyrosine kinases ABL1/2, SRC, EPHA2/5, LCK, YES1, KIT, PDGFRB, FYN, BTK, BCR, CSK, EPHB4, FGR, FRK, LYN
Serine/threonine kinases ZAK, MAPK14,
Transcription factors STAT5B, NR4A3,
Heat shock protein HSPA8
Phosphoribosyltransferase PPAT
ATP-dependent efflux pump ABCB1
ATP-binding cassette ABCG2
Nafarelin acetate Gonadotropin-releasing hormone (GnRH) agonist G-protein-coupled receptors GNRHR
Afatinib ATP-competitive tyrosine kinase inhibitor (ErbB family) Tyrosine kinases EGFR, ERBB2/4
ATP-dependent efflux pump ABCB1
ATP-binding cassette ABCG2
Neratinib ATP-competitive tyrosine kinase inhibitor (HER2/EGFR) Tyrosine kinases EGFR, HER2
Serum proteins ALB, AAG
ATP-dependent efflux pump ABCB1
Polymyxin B sulphate Antibiotic LPS of Gram-negative bacteria outer membrane Displaces Ca2+ and Mg2+ from LPS increasing membrane permeability
